What you’ll need:

  • 6 Tbsp. unsalted butter

  • 1/2 cup sweetened condensed milk

  • 1 tsp. vanilla extract

  • 10 oz. big or mini marshmallows

  • 6 cups rice krispy cereal

  • one big pan to put them in

Instructions:

  • In a large pot, melt butter until it starts to bubble.

  • Next, add in the condensed milk, and stir. When it starts to boil, let sit for about a minute.

  • Add in the vanilla as well as marshmallows. Stir till marshmallows are fully melted.

  • Remove from heat. Add in all of your rice krispy cereal. Stir together and make sure it is mixed together evenly.

  • Grab your pan, lightly spray/grease it and add in your Krispy mix. Use a spatula to move it into place.

  • Allow mixture to set. Usually takes 30 minutes or so then cut and serve!

Depending on the season, you could add in sprinkles or something fun and festive to your mix or to sprinkle on top. Maybe even cut some out with cookie cutters to create something even cooler!
